About J.H. Nelson

J.H. Nelson is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Aerospace Engineering and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ality, having authored 53 papers that have together received 3.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Integrated Energy Systems Optimization (8 papers), Environmental Impact and Sustainability (7 papers), Combustion and Detonation Processes (6 papers), Indoor Air Quality and Microbial Exposure (6 papers), Fire dynamics and safety research (6 papers),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(4 papers), Air Quality Monitoring and Forecasting (4 papers) and Climate Change Policy and Economics (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(708 citations), Energy Engineering and Power Technology (120 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(249 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(399 citations) and Materials Chemistry (1.1k citations). J.H. Nelson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Young Hee Yoon, A. Paul Alivisatos, Daniel M. Kammen, Josiah Johnston, Ana Mileva, Shaul Aloni, Elena V. Shevchenko, Bryce Sadtler, Dmitri V. Talapin and Gordana Duković. Their work appears in journals such as American Industrial Hygiene Association Journal, Nature Climate Change,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Environmental Science & Technology and Nano Letters.
